Приветствую всех!
Вообщем проблема такая как нибудь можно в Python создать модуль находящийся в том же каталоге что и пакет и имеющий одно имя, и чтобы Python нонимал что когда я пишу import <module> он импортировал имена из модуля а когда import <module>.<inpackagename> обращался бы уже к пакету
Если кратенько для понятности проилюстрировать тодопустим есть такая структура каталогов;
<module>
<inpackagename1>.py
<inpackagename2>.py
<inpackagename3>.py
<module>.py
а хотелось бы чтобы при
import <module>
имена брались из <module>.py
а когда
import <module>.<inpackagename>
имена брались из <inpackagename>
Posted via RSDN NNTP Server 2.1 beta
Здравствуйте, meandr, Вы писали:
M>Приветствую всех!
M>Вообщем проблема такая как нибудь можно в Python создать модуль находящийся в том же каталоге что и пакет и имеющий одно имя, и чтобы Python нонимал что когда я пишу import <module> он импортировал имена из модуля а когда import <module>.<inpackagename> обращался бы уже к пакету
M>Если кратенько для понятности проилюстрировать тодопустим есть такая структура каталогов;
Почитайте
здесь. Обратите внимание на описание зверька —
__init__.py
Re: Как в Python создать модуль одноименный с пакетом
Вы знате я читал этот опус, но в нем нет ответа на мой вопрос
Posted via RSDN NNTP Server 2.1 beta
Re[3]: Как в Python создать модуль одноименный с пакетом
От спасибо дорогой ты человек, я бы даже сказал человечище
Posted via RSDN NNTP Server 2.1 beta